1. Understanding the Digital Planner Market
Before you start designing your digital planner, it’s essential to have a thorough understanding of the market trends, preferences, and competitors. Research popular digital planners, analyze customer reviews, and identify gaps that your product can fill.
2. Defining Your Niche and Target Audience
Narrow down your focus by selecting a niche for your digital planner. Are you catering to students, professionals, or creative enthusiasts? Define your target audience’s pain points, preferences, and needs to tailor your planner accordingly.
3. Setting Clear Goals for Your Digital Planner
Establish clear objectives for your digital planner. Do you want to help users stay organized, boost productivity, or promote creativity? Setting goals will guide your design process and ensure your planner aligns with your vision.
4. Choosing the Right Platform and Tools
Select a suitable platform or software for designing your digital planner. Popular options include platforms like GoodNotes, Notability, or digital design software such as Adobe Illustrator or Procreate. Familiarize yourself with the tools and features they offer.
5. Creating a User-Friendly Interface
Design an intuitive and user-friendly interface that allows effortless navigation. Keep the layout organized and clutter-free, making it easy for users to find and use different sections of the planner.
6. Designing Eye-Catching Templates
Your digital planner’s templates should be visually appealing and aligned with your brand identity. Use a consistent color palette, typography, and graphics that resonate with your target audience.
7. Incorporating Functional Hyperlinks and Navigation
Make your digital planner interactive by adding hyperlinks and navigation buttons. This feature enables users to jump between sections, making the planner more convenient and efficient to use.
8. Integrating Interactive Elements
Consider incorporating interactive elements like checkboxes, dropdown menus, and progress trackers. These features enhance user engagement and provide practical functionalities.
9. Adding Value with Customizable Features
Offer customizable sections and templates to cater to individual preferences. Allow users to personalize their digital planners, making the experience more personalized and enjoyable.
10. Optimizing for Mobile Devices
Ensure your digital planner is responsive and compatible with various devices, including smartphones and tablets. A mobile-friendly design extends your reach and accessibility.
11. Ensuring Accessibility for All Users
Make your digital planner accessible to users with disabilities. Use alt text for images, provide high contrast options, and ensure compatibility with screen readers for a more inclusive experience.
12. Implementing an Effective Pricing Strategy
Determine a pricing strategy that reflects the value of your digital planner while remaining competitive. Consider offering different pricing tiers or a subscription model for ongoing access.
13. Creating Compelling Marketing Materials
Craft persuasive marketing materials that showcase the benefits of your digital planner. Utilize captivating visuals, informative videos, and compelling copy to attract potential customers.
14. Launching and Promoting Your Digital Planner
Plan a successful launch by building anticipation through social media teasers, countdowns, and sneak peeks. Collaborate with influencers or bloggers in your niche to spread the word and generate buzz.
15. Gathering and Utilizing Customer Feedback
After launching your digital planner, actively seek feedback from your customers. Use their insights to improve your product, fix any issues, and continue enhancing the user experience.
